In the brain it is active in the hippocampus, cortex, and basal forebrain—areas vital to learning, memory, and higher thinking. BDNF is also expressed in the retina, kidneys, prostate, motor neurons, and skeletal muscle, and is also found in saliva. BDNF itself is important for long-term memory.
Where is BDNF secreted?
BDNF synthesis, processing, sorting, transport and secretion in neurons. BDNF is synthesized in the endoplasmic reticulum (ER) as a 32 kDa precursor protein (proBDNF) that moves though the Golgi apparatus to the trans Golgi network (TGN), from where it passes into the constitutive and regulated secretory pathways.
Which brain cells produce BDNF?
Since then, the important role of BDNF in regulating the survival and differentiation of various neuronal populations including sensory neurons, cerebellar neurons, and spinal motor neurons has been firmly established (2). Neurons are the major source of BDNF in the nervous system (2, 3).
What increases BDNF the most?
Studies suggest that intense aerobic exercise is the most effective physical activity to increase your BDNF levels[25][26]. Although exercise increases BDNF immediately, the results appear to be better when you exercise regularly[25].

What stimulates BDNF release?
The best characterized stimuli are patterns of neuronal electrical activity like prolonged depolarization, high-frequency stimulation (HFS), or theta-burst stimulation (TBS) that trigger BDNF release in developing and mature neurons (Edelmann et al.
How is BDNF regulated?
They are both up-regulated by the activation of L-VGCC or NMDAR. Inhibition of MEK or CaMK activity decreased the basal level as well as Ca2+-stimulated increase of both promoter IV activity and BDNF IV mRNA. PKA or PI3K activity is only required for Ca2+-stimulated up-regulation of both promoter IV and BDNF IV mRNA.

What decreases BDNF?
Sleep disturbances decrease BDNF levels and the loss of sleep results in high vulnerability to stress and consequently leads to decrease in BDNF levels [15]. Stress is a potent risk factor for depression and is associated with decreased BDNF concentration in animal models.
What reduces BDNF?
Cortisol Reduces BDNF
For all the benefits of BDNF, there are other factors that work against it. The stress hormone cortisol acts in opposition to BDNF, reducing BDNF levels as it increases. This means that when you are under stress, you are less able to learn and adapt your thinking.

Is BDNF real?
Brain-derived neurotrophic factor (BDNF), or abrineurin, is a protein that, in humans, is encoded by the BDNF gene. BDNF is a member of the neurotrophin family of growth factors, which are related to the canonical nerve growth factor. Neurotrophic factors are found in the brain and the periphery.
